MATRAC 2 Winter School. Application of Neutrons and Synchrotron Radiation in Materials Science with special focus on Fundamental Aspects of Materials
| - |
In Utting/Ammersee
The school will be held in Utting/Ammersee and Garching/Munich, Germany, in cooperation with the Röntgen-Ã...ngström-Cluster (http://www.rontgen-angstrom.eu) and the BMBF (Bundesministerium für Bildung und Forschung, Germany).
The Winter School will provide a systematic overview of the application of neutrons and synchrotron radiation to the structural analysis of materials. The school starts with the fundamentals of synchrotron radiation and neutron scattering. The focus is subsequently shifted towards neutron techniques and their application to specific problems in materials science. Different classes of modern functional materials are presented and it will be shown how neutron scattering, on the one hand, and synchrotron radiation, on the other hand, can be used to explore the microscopic mechanisms that are responsible for their properties. While fundamental aspects are dominating, application related phenomena will be covered as well.
After a two-day theoretical course in Utting/Ammersee the participants will spend two days at the FRM II in Garching (near Munich) doing practicals. The fifth day of the school offers further talks and a final discussion. All relevant experimental methods will be covered.

The 22nd meeting of the International Collaboration on Advanced Neutron Sources (ICANS XXII) will be held on the 27th -31st March 2017 in Oxford, England.
For more details, visit: Â http://icansxxii.iopconfs.org/home
 The abstract submission deadline is 30 November 2016.  ICANS is an informal network of laboratories whose scientists and engineers are involved in developing pulsed neutron sources and accelerator based spallation neutron sources.  The collaboration was founded in 1977 as a forum to promote discussions and collaborative work, and to share information on three main topics: accelerators, targets and moderators, and instruments.  After 24 years, the meeting returns to the UK and will be hosted by the ISIS Neutron and Muon Source at the Said Business School, University of Oxford with accommodation at St Anne’s College.  In addition to the core areas of accelerators, target and instrumentation, other key areas such as sample environment, data analysis and computing, polarisation, detectors, shielding and neutronics will be discussed.  It is the principal goal of ICANS to promote and facilitate informal discussions and, as such, the meeting will comprise several workshop sessions.   Key dates: Abstract submission deadline: 30 November 2016 Early registration deadline: 31 January 2017 Registration deadline: 17 March 2017 Paper submission deadline: 27 March 2017

HERCULES European School
| - |
In Grenoble
This one month course, coordinated by the Université Grenoble Alpes, is designed to provide training for students, postdoctoral and senior scientists from European and non-European universities and laboratories, in the field of Neutron and Synchrotron Radiation for condensed matter studies (Biology, Chemistry, Physics, Materials Science, Geosciences, Industrial applications). It includes lectures, practicals and tutorials, visits of Large Facilities and a poster session (each participant puts up a poster about her/his thesis or research topic for a day).
- PART I: BASIC METHODS AND INSTRUMENTS :
(This part is common for all the participants - 1.5 weeks) - PART II is divided into two parallel specialized sessions (3.5 weeks) :
- Session A: PHYSICS AND CHEMISTRY OF CONDENSED MATTER
- Session B: BIOMOLECULAR STRUCTURE AND DYNAMICS
The course is held in Grenoble at the Polygone Scientifique Louis Néel. This is close to partner institutions where practicals and tutorials will take place:
- European Molecular Biology Laboratory (EMBL)
- European Synchrotron Radiation Facility (ESRF)
- Institut de Biologie Structurale (IBS)
- Institut Laue-Langevin (ILL)
- Institut Nanosciences & Cryogénie (CEA)
- Institut Néel (CNRS)
A special seven days programme is included , in a partner institution among European Large instruments, either at:
- DESY and European XFEL in Hambourg, Germany
- Elettra and FERMI in Trieste, Italy
- Swiss Light Source / Paul Scherrer Institute in Villigen, Switzerland
- SOLEIL (St Aubin, France) and Laboratoire Léon Brillouin (CEA Saclay, France)
The language of the course is English.
